From Sailing Trips to Booze Cruises: Top Barcelona Boat Tours

Last Updated: 23/10/2017

Segway tours…rickshaw rides…tBoat Tours in Barcelonahere are hundreds of tours and excursions in Barcelona offering new and innovative ways to see the city. But as the warmer months arrive once more in the Catalan capital, you may want to opt for something more, shall we say, offshore. Well, there’s no better way to cool down on a hot summer’s day than by enjoying a nice sea breeze port-side a boat tour. Looking inland from the sparkling Mediterranean Sea, the beautiful Barcelona skyline is an amazing sight, and whether you fancy a relaxing day out with the family, or even if you’re a party animal trying to test out your sea legs, Barcelona’s boat tours offer something for everyone. Just be sure not to forget your swimsuit and sunscreen!

 

Barcelona Booze CruiseBarcelona Booze Cruise

If you’re someone who just loves to party, or you’re on a bachelor or bachelorette party in Barcelona, this is one boat tour that you can’t miss. The Barcelona Boat Party by Stoke Travel sets sail from Port Olímpic three times a week, with trips ranging from a two to a three hour party on board. Choose your outing from 3 different fun-filled fiestas: Boozey Thursdays, Spanish Saturdays, and BBQ Days on Saturdays and Sundays. All trips provide an on-board DJ so you can dance the day away right in the midst of stunning coastal views of Barcelona, and each cruise features an open bar packed to its fullest with beer and sangria. What’s more, if this tour doesn’t satisfy your inner party animal, your ticket also comes with free club entry and discounted drinks once the cruise returns to shore! But remember to drink responsibly!

 

Need for SpeedX-Max Speed Boat Tours, Barcelona

If you like to get your adrenaline pumping, then this one’s definitely for you! X-Max Speed Boat Tours allow you to mix the leisure of the sea with the excitement of a speed boat. On this fifty minute tour, you will depart from the harbor in the shadow of the Columbus monument, heading through Port Vell where you’ll get an up-close look at some super-yachts and the huge Barcelona fishing fleet. Then you’ll continue through Port Olímpic for breathtaking views of the city and then loop around Port Fòrum. Although this tour leans toward the quick side, it is sure to fulfill your need for adventure. On vacation in Barcelona with friends? Don’t worry; this Barcelona boat tour is also available for private charters for larger groups.

Wine Tasting Cruises

Barcelona Boat Tours: Wine Tasting Cruise

 

Among Catalonia’s many charming characteristics is its world famous wine. Orsom Barcelona offers many boat tours in Barcelona, and always with spectacular views. However, only one combines both of these Barcelona attractions: the unique Wine Tasting Cruise. This one of a kind tour allows you to take in the sights of Barcelona’s beautiful coast while a professional sommelier walks you through a spectacular tasting of some of Spain’s specialty wines. Try products from emerging wine areas, as well as from the famous Rioja and Penedès regions. Perfect for large groups, this tour is only available for private charter.

 

All Aboard! Sailing Skills and Boat Charters

 

Barcelona Boat Tours, Private YachtsIf you have always wanted to learn to sail then what better place try than on the beautiful Mediterranean? Barcelona Sailing Trip offers customers a two hour sailing tutorial along the city’s magnificent coastline. Here, you will be trained in basic sailing techniques from an English speaking instructor while taking in views of Barcelona’s Port Olímpic. Take advantage of wind-power during this wonderful sea excursion. Don’t forget to wash down your new found skill with a complementary glass of Cava!

Already know how to sail? Grab some friends, head down to the beach and charter your own sailboat for a few hours with Barcelona’s Skyline BCN. What could be better than a day out on the Mediterranean with some close friends? Under the guidance of a professional skipper, take turns captaining the boat while others go out for a swim or enjoy the sun. You can even rent a yacht, a motorboat, a catamaran or a jet ski: there’s something for everyone! So, don’t miss out on this opportunity for a truly unique sailing experience.
